Special thanks to Read to Me, a service of the Idaho Commission for Libraries. Read to Me is an early literacy initiative which provides information, training, technical assistance, and resources for Idaho libraries and their community partners. This project made possible by a grant form the U.S. Institute of Museum and Library Services under the provision of the Library Service Technology Act.
